As I said in my intro, I'm currently shooting a Tanfoglio Gold Eric Custom 2010 in 38 Super in the major power factor division. As the Tanfoglio shooters amongst us would know, this pistol is referred to as the V12 model due to the 8 ports along the barrel and 4 portings on the compensator.

There are only 2 vertical gas chambers that have been cut in the compensator as a result of all of the porting. Due to all of the porting prior to the compensator, it is relatively small in comparison to STI and SV compensators.

The down side to all of the porting is the result it has on reloading for major power factor. To make the bare cut off for major power factor I am loading a minumum of 8.8 grains of ADI 's AP100. To load too much higher results in broken slide pins - the Henning hardened slide pin has resolved that drama.

My solution to the problem and to reduce the load pressures is to rebarrel the pistol with an unported barrel and attach a better compensator similar to the Brazo Thundercomp.

Meat Pie, what about this idea:

-buy a standard large frame 4.5" 9mm barrel (no cone)

-turn the end of the barrel down to .575" OD (it's 15mm right now, or .591")

-thread it .575X40

-install the cone fit Thundercomp

I'm assuming the cone on the Brazos comp would be similar enough to lock up in your Tanfo slide with little modification, but I've never handled one, so it's just a guess.

G'day lads. Sorry for the absence. A quick update with the Tanfoglio; I imported a complete Henning custom flat trigger kit just before their Home Land Security shut everything down. Shoots like a jet now! 2.8lb trigger pull & the trigger is as crisp as an icicle!

With regards to the barrel & compensator, I got cold feet. I watched one of our club members go down this path and it resulted in a Pandora's box of drama.

I decided to go the way of adding a whole new pistol to the stable and ordered an STI Edge in 38 super through Peter Muscrat. I had to wait a few months and pay quite a bit more than the cost of a barrel and compensator but it has been a pure joy since she arrived!
